How I Chose the Right Shade

Picking the right shade mattered a lot to me. I learned that hair dye results can vary depending on my starting hair color, so I didn’t rely only on the box color. I compared the shade chart carefully and thought about whether I wanted a subtle change or a more dramatic one. If someone is buying it for the first time, I would suggest choosing a shade close to their natural color for a safer first try.

Application Tips I Found Helpful

A few things made the process easier for me:

  • I did a patch test before using the dye.
  • I sectioned my hair so I could apply the color evenly.
  • I followed the timing instructions instead of guessing.
  • I used gloves and protected my skin and clothes.
  • I deep-conditioned after coloring to keep my hair soft.
